Leo Triplet (M65 M66 and NGC3628 <the hamburger galaxy>)
30 to 35 million light years away.

Pretty happy with how this came out 7 hours and 10mins worth of exposures over about 4 days of the new moon. Mostly at home (Bortle 5/6) but some from a dark sky location (watts bridge with seqas) (Bortle 2)


Amazing to think of the countless billions of stars , planets and civilizations in this pic.

80mm apo (explorer scientific triplet)
HEQ5
asi533-mc
asi120mm + svbony 50mm guidescope

sharpcap for polar alignment
phd2 for guiding
APT for captuures
DSS+StarTools for stacking and processing.
full calibration frames
